National Student Legal Defense Network
National Student Legal Defense Network reported paying Aaron Ament, President, $281,754 in total compensation (FY 2023).
That places Aaron Ament at approximately the 88th percentile among 237 similarly sized civil rights & advocacy nonprofits (median $155,136).
